Crossroads Care Center
Last Updated: 2/1/2024
Legal Business Name | CROSSROADS WORTHINGTON OPERATIONS LLC |
Affiliated Entity | |
Region | Midwest |
Address | 965 MCMILLAN STREET, Worthington, Minnesota 56187 |
County | Nobles County |
Phone | 5073765312 |
CMS Certification Number CCN | 245395 |
Owership Type | For profit - Corporation |
Nurse Hours Per Resident Per Day | 4.01838 |
Health Survey Score | 71.333 |
Reported Incidents | 6 |
Number of Complaints | 1 |
Infection Control Citations | |
Number of Fines | 4 |
Amount of Fines | $71650.0 |
Payment Denials | 1 |
Facility Rating Comparisons (Scale 1-5)
Rating Type | Provider | State | Region | National |
---|---|---|---|---|
Overall Rating | 2.0 | 3.2 | 2.9 | 2.87 |
Health | 2.0 | - | - | - |
Quality | 4.0 | 3.6 | 3.5 | 3.5 |
Short-Stay | 4.0 | - | - | - |
Long-Stay | 4.0 | - | - | - |
Turnover % | 57.6% | 48.4% | 54.6% | 52.72% |
Staffing | 4.0 | 3.8 | 2.7 | 2.7 |
Understanding Crossroads Care Center Ratings
Crossroads Care Center, located in Worthington, MN, is a long-term care facility that provides services to the community within the 56187 zip code in Nobles County. The facility has an overall rating of 2.0 out of 5 based on our reviews, reflecting the quality of care and services offered. Compared to the state average, Crossroads Care Center's overall rating is notably lower, standing at -38%. This indicates that the facility's performance is below the typical standards observed within the state of Minnesota. Additionally, on a national scale, Crossroads Care Center falls -30% lower in terms of overall rating compared to other long-term care facilities across the country.

Staffing Ratings and Turnover at Crossroads Care Center
When evaluating nursing homes, staffing ratings play a crucial role in determining the level of care residents can expect. Crossroads Care Center has a staffing rating of 4.0, which is 5% higher than the state average and 48% higher than the national average. This higher rating indicates that Crossroads Care Center has more nursing staff available to tend to residents' needs compared to many other facilities. Adequate staffing is directly linked to the quality of care provided, as more staff members can ensure prompt assistance and personalized attention for each resident. On the other hand, turnover rates among nursing staff can also shed light on the quality of care at a facility. Crossroads Care Center exhibits a total nursing staff turnover of 57.6%, which is significantly higher than the state average by 19% and the national average by 9%. High turnover rates may indicate challenges in staff retention, which can impact the continuity and consistency of care provided to residents. Facilities with high turnover rates may struggle to maintain experienced staff and could experience disruptions in care delivery.
